But Pacific Island nations have particular rationale for being nervous. You will find there's noxious legacy of nuclear tests from the region, and various nations around the world have Traditionally handled the Pacific as a dumping ground for their waste. The U.S. done sixty seven nuclear exams in the Marshall Islands involving 1946 and 1957—and disposed of atomic waste in Runit Dome, exactly where it’s even now stored.

That testing led not merely to forced relocations, but additionally to improved premiums of cancers. These days There may be worry that the dome is leaking and that mounting sea degrees might impact its structural integrity. France also executed 193 nuclear exams from 1966 to 1996 at Moruroa and Fangataufa atolls in French Polynesia.
